Appendix table 5. Unemployment rates by age of youngest child 2010 - 2011, population aged 20-59

  Year
2010 2011
Unemployment rate, % Unemployment rate, %
Both sexes Total 7,8 7,2
Parents of children under 18 years total 5,0 4,2
- youngest child under 3 years 6,0 5,1
- youngest child between 3 and 6 years 5,4 5,2
- youngest child between 7 and 17 years 4,4 3,4
No children under 18 years 9,4 8,9
Males Total 8,6 7,9
Parents of children under 18 years total 4,2 3,7
- youngest child under 3 years 4,7 4,2
- youngest child between 3 and 6 years 4,0 3,1
- youngest child between 7 and 17 years 4,0 3,6
No children under 18 years 11,4 10,5
Females Total 6,8 6,4
Parents of children under 18 years total 5,9 4,9
- youngest child under 3 years 8,3 6,5
- youngest child between 3 and 6 years 6,8 7,4
- youngest child between 7 and 17 years 4,8 3,2
No children under 18 years 7,4 7,3

Source: Labour Force Survey 2011. Statistics Finland
